CHEAP SALE OF , DRAPERY, BOOTS, and SHOES. At the MELBOURNE HOUSE, St. Ba'than’s. Eon One Month Only, DM'CONNOCHIE begs mort • respectfully to return his thanks to the Inhabitants of St. Bathan’s Hill’s Creek, Wools!ieel, Welshman’s Gully, and the surrounding district for the liberal support he has received from them'for the past three years, and bogs to state that all the Y ALU ABLE STOCK, amounting to £2OOO, shall bo Ren arked, and Sold at Prices hitherto unheard of upon the Goldfields of Otago. Sale to commence on Saturday, the 26 th of November. A reasonable Discount allowed on all Wholesale Parcels. At the expiration of One Month the remaining Stock, Including large Iron Store, Fixtures, &c., will be Sold by Tender. The date of calling for Tenders and closing of the Store, &c., will appear in a future issue. All out-standing Accounts MUST I'E PAID on or before the Ist of January, 1870.
